Football Recap: Burney Raiders vs. Butte Valley Bulldogs
Two teams were on the hunt for playoff glory, but only Burney walked away with it. They secured a 24-18 W over the Butte Valley Bulldogs on Thursday. That's the second time they've managed to beat them this season, as they also won 44-0 back in September.
A big part of Burney's victory came down to the chemistry between Killian Biles and his top target Liam Von Schalscha. Biles rushed for 104 yards and one touchdown while Von Schalscha rushed for 84 yards and a pair of TDs.

Burney's defense made their presence known, laying out the QB 5.5 times. Leading the way was Greeley Wolfin with two sacks. Burney is undefeated when Wolfin posts one or more sacks, but 3-4 otherwise. Another thorn in Butte Valley's side was Alexander Vargas, who picked up 0.5 sacks and made 18 total tackles.
The win made it two in a row for Burney and bumps their season record up to 7-4. The victories came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 38.0 points over those games. As for Butte Valley, their defeat ended a three-game streak of wins at home and dropped them to 5-5.
Looking ahead, Burney will head out on the road to face off against Loyalton at 6:00 p.m. on the 15th. Butte Valley does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
